Junior After School Programming

Preschool

This class is an entry level introduction to tennis for preschool aged children.

Mon & Wed | 4:00 – 4:30pm | Ages 3 – 5

Red Futures

For beginner-intermediate level red ball players between who are relatively new to tennis or players that have aged up from the Preschool Tennis level of classes. Some prior tennis or other sport experience is recommended for this group, but not required. Using the USTA’s Red Ball 3 curriculum, players will learn the fundamentals of being an athlete and begin the basic fundamentals of groundstrokes, serves, volleys and rally skills.  

Mon – Thu | 4:30 – 5:00pm | Ages 6 – 8

Orange Futures

For beginner-intermediate level orange ball players who have advanced from Red Futures or who meet the requirements through the Red Ball assessment test and invited by a coach. Using the USTA’s Orange Ball 2 and Orange Ball 1 curriculum, players will continue to build on their athletic and tennis fundamentals which are groundstrokes, serves, volleys, footwork and rally skills. At this level, players will be able to rally from the baseline of the 36′ court with top spin, serve and return with rally, transition to the net, volley and begin to play out a 7 point tie break with a partner. 

Mon & Wed | 6:00 – 7:00pm | Ages 9 & 10

Green Futures

For beginner-intermediate level green ball players who have advanced from Orange Challengers or meet the age requirements. Players should be familiar with the fundamentals of tennis and have had some prior instruction. Using the USTA’s Green Ball 3 curriculum, players will continue to build the fundamentals of their tennis game improving their topspin and slice baseline game (forehand and backhand), serve/return, transition and net play and begin to learn to play singles and doubles full set matches.

Mon & Wed | 6:00 – 7:00pm | Ages 11 & 12

Yellow Futures

For beginner-intermediate level players who have advanced and aged out of Green Futures or who have been assessed by a coach. Players at this level will use the yellow ball and should have a firm grasp on the fundamentals (serves, returns, forehand/backhand groundstrokes, volleys, slice). Some previous tennis training is required for this group. Curriculum will be based on the USTA’s Green Ball 3, Green Ball 2 and Green Ball 3 using the yellow ball. We recommend that players attend both Mondays and Wednesdays to develop properly and to advance to the next level.  

Mon & Wed | 4:30 – 6:00pm | Ages 12 – 17

Yellow Challengers

For intermediate to advanced level players who have advanced from Yellow Futures or who have been assessed and referred by a coach. Players at this level should have had some match experience with USTA L7, Junior Team Tennis or middle school/high school tennis. Curriculum will be based around the USTA’s Green Ball 1 and other drills associated competitive and high performance junior tennis players. This class meets 4 days per week, however you can pick which day(s) of the session that you would like to attend.  Each session lasts 4-5 weeks (month).  We recommend that at this level players attend 2-4 days per week in order to improve at the proper rate.

Mon – Thu | 4:30 – 6:00pm | Ages 11 – 17
